18 And I told them how the hand of my God had been favorable to me and also about the king’s words which he had spoken to me. Then they said, “Let’s arise and build.” (A)So they put their hands to the good work. 19 But when Sanballat the Horonite and Tobiah the Ammonite [a]official, and (B)Geshem the Arab heard about it, (C)they mocked us and despised us, and said, “What is this thing that you are doing? (D)Are you rebelling against the king?” 20 So I answered them and said to them, “(E)The God of heaven will make us successful; therefore we His servants will arise and build, (F)but you have no part, right, or memorial in Jerusalem.”
